Updated Position to use Weak / strong references for Level objects

This commit is contained in:
Shoghi Cervantes
2014-05-22 04:14:06 +02:00
parent 6328834681
commit c1546aac9c
60 changed files with 584 additions and 291 deletions

View File

@ -76,7 +76,7 @@ abstract class Tile extends Position{
public function __construct(Level $level, Compound $nbt){
$this->server = Server::getInstance();
$this->level = $level;
$this->setLevel($level, true); //Strong reference
$this->namedtag = $nbt;
$this->closed = false;
$this->name = "";